Down-selection and outdoor evaluation of novel, halotolerant algal strains for winter cultivation, 18s sequencing

The goal of this study was to select algal strains suitable for growth in winter conditions in Mesa Arizona. A novel photobioreactor was used to down select strains via light and temperature cycling representative of outdoor algae ponds. After down selection strains were deployed outdoors in 1000 L algal raceway ponds in the winter to corroborate indoor data. 18s sequencing data is supplied here as this was used to phylogenically genotype the strains
